Thu May 5 12:07:28 2022 UTC ()
kitty: don't attempt to install .orig files


(nia)
diff -r1.30 -r1.31 pkgsrc/x11/kitty/Makefile

cvs diff -r1.30 -r1.31 pkgsrc/x11/kitty/Makefile (expand / switch to unified diff)

--- pkgsrc/x11/kitty/Makefile 2022/04/14 07:20:39 1.30
+++ pkgsrc/x11/kitty/Makefile 2022/05/05 12:07:28 1.31
@@ -1,14 +1,14 @@ @@ -1,14 +1,14 @@
1# $NetBSD: Makefile,v 1.30 2022/04/14 07:20:39 pin Exp $ 1# $NetBSD: Makefile,v 1.31 2022/05/05 12:07:28 nia Exp $
2 2
3DISTNAME= kitty-0.25.0 3DISTNAME= kitty-0.25.0
4CATEGORIES= x11 4CATEGORIES= x11
5MASTER_SITES= ${MASTER_SITE_GITHUB:=kovidgoyal/} 5MASTER_SITES= ${MASTER_SITE_GITHUB:=kovidgoyal/}
6GITHUB_PROJECT= kitty 6GITHUB_PROJECT= kitty
7GITHUB_RELEASE= v${PKGVERSION_NOREV} 7GITHUB_RELEASE= v${PKGVERSION_NOREV}
8EXTRACT_SUFX= .tar.xz 8EXTRACT_SUFX= .tar.xz
9 9
10MAINTAINER= pkgsrc-users@NetBSD.org 10MAINTAINER= pkgsrc-users@NetBSD.org
11HOMEPAGE= https://sw.kovidgoyal.net/kitty/index.html 11HOMEPAGE= https://sw.kovidgoyal.net/kitty/index.html
12COMMENT= GPU based terminal emulator 12COMMENT= GPU based terminal emulator
13LICENSE= gnu-gpl-v3 13LICENSE= gnu-gpl-v3
14 14
@@ -33,26 +33,27 @@ PY_PATCHPLIST= yes @@ -33,26 +33,27 @@ PY_PATCHPLIST= yes
33 33
34do-build: 34do-build:
35 cd ${WRKSRC} && ${MAKE_ENV} ${PYTHONBIN} setup.py linux-package 35 cd ${WRKSRC} && ${MAKE_ENV} ${PYTHONBIN} setup.py linux-package
36 36
37do-install: 37do-install:
38 cd ${WRKSRC} && ${MAKE_ENV} ${PYTHONBIN} setup.py linux-package \ 38 cd ${WRKSRC} && ${MAKE_ENV} ${PYTHONBIN} setup.py linux-package \
39 --prefix ${DESTDIR}${PREFIX} 39 --prefix ${DESTDIR}${PREFIX}
40 ${MV} ${DESTDIR}${PREFIX}/share/man/man1/kitty.1 \ 40 ${MV} ${DESTDIR}${PREFIX}/share/man/man1/kitty.1 \
41 ${DESTDIR}${PREFIX}/${PKGMANDIR}/man1/kitty.1 || ${TRUE} 41 ${DESTDIR}${PREFIX}/${PKGMANDIR}/man1/kitty.1 || ${TRUE}
42 ${MV} ${DESTDIR}${PREFIX}/share/man/man5/kitty.conf.5 \ 42 ${MV} ${DESTDIR}${PREFIX}/share/man/man5/kitty.conf.5 \
43 ${DESTDIR}${PREFIX}/${PKGMANDIR}/man5/kitty.conf.5 || ${TRUE} 43 ${DESTDIR}${PREFIX}/${PKGMANDIR}/man5/kitty.conf.5 || ${TRUE}
44# pkgsrc framwork only handles optimization level 1 files correctly 44# pkgsrc framwork only handles optimization level 1 files correctly
45 ${FIND} ${DESTDIR} -type f -name *.opt-2.pyc -print0 | ${XARGS} -0 ${RM} -rf 45 ${FIND} ${DESTDIR} -type f -name *.opt-2.pyc -print0 | ${XARGS} -0 ${RM} -rf
 46 ${FIND} ${DESTDIR} -name '*.orig' -exec rm -rf '{}' ';'
46 47
47.include "../../mk/bsd.prefs.mk" 48.include "../../mk/bsd.prefs.mk"
48 49
49.if ${OPSYS} != "Darwin" 50.if ${OPSYS} != "Darwin"
50.include "../../graphics/freetype2/buildlink3.mk" 51.include "../../graphics/freetype2/buildlink3.mk"
51.include "../../fonts/fontconfig/buildlink3.mk" 52.include "../../fonts/fontconfig/buildlink3.mk"
52.endif 53.endif
53 54
54.include "options.mk" 55.include "options.mk"
55.include "../../graphics/hicolor-icon-theme/buildlink3.mk" 56.include "../../graphics/hicolor-icon-theme/buildlink3.mk"
56.include "../../graphics/lcms2/buildlink3.mk" 57.include "../../graphics/lcms2/buildlink3.mk"
57.include "../../devel/ncurses/buildlink3.mk" 58.include "../../devel/ncurses/buildlink3.mk"
58.include "../../devel/zlib/buildlink3.mk" 59.include "../../devel/zlib/buildlink3.mk"